Transaction 21e758d1c5d40c29306253d83aabf0d9250ed252e629310a1ff84e95a0bbf29b

1 Input
2 Outputs
  • 21e758d1c5d40c29306253d83aabf0d9250ed252e629310a1ff84e95a0bbf29b:0
  • value  34574
    address  39FsJSYhX1GKjPXYNU41Q9ota18h32q8qA
  • 21e758d1c5d40c29306253d83aabf0d9250ed252e629310a1ff84e95a0bbf29b:1
  • value  36014642
    address  1HNNoP9X6948aZmRA97jiK2qxevmX4Swpk